What is a Traceability System?

A traceability system is a set of procedures and technologies that allow companies to track products and materials throughout the entire supply chain. This includes the raw materials used in production, the manufacturing process, and the distribution of finished products.

Traceability systems can use various technologies such as RFID tags, barcodes, and GPS tracking to monitor products and materials in real-time. It allows companies to have complete visibility over their supply chain, which can help them identify and address potential issues quickly.

Benefits of Traceability Systems

There are several benefits to implementing a traceability system in your industry or organization. Here are some of the key benefits:

  1. Improved Product Quality: With a traceability system in place, companies can monitor the quality of their products at every stage of production. This allows them to identify any quality issues early on and take corrective action before the product reaches the end-user.
  2. Enhanced Safety: Traceability systems can help ensure the safety of products by tracking their origins, ingredients, and production processes. This can be particularly important in industries such as food and pharmaceuticals, where safety is a top priority.
  3. Increased Efficiency: Traceability systems can help companies streamline their supply chain processes by providing real-time visibility into the movement of products and materials. This can help reduce waste, improve inventory management, and optimize logistics.
  4. Compliance with Regulations: Many industries are subject to strict regulations and standards, such as those related to food safety and product labeling. Traceability systems can help companies comply with these regulations by providing accurate and timely data.

Implementing a Traceability System

Implementing a traceability system will depend on the specific needs of your industry or organization. However, there are some general steps that can be followed:

  • Identify the Scope: Determine the scope of your traceability system by defining the products, materials, and processes that need to be tracked.
  • Choose the Technology: Select the appropriate technology for your traceability system, such as RFID, barcodes, or GPS tracking.
  • Define Procedures: Establish procedures for collecting, storing, and sharing data within the traceability system.
  • Train Staff: Train employees on how to use the traceability system and ensure that they understand the importance of data accuracy and integrity.
  • Test and Monitor: Test the traceability system and monitor its performance to ensure that it is functioning correctly.
